Common Challenges in Beta Blocker Therapy

1. Bradycardia and Heart Block

One of the primary concerns with beta blocker therapy is the development of bradycardia, a slower than normal heart rate, and conduction abnormalities such as heart block. These effects occur because beta blockers inhibit sympathetic stimulation of the heart, reducing heart rate and conduction velocity.

2. Hypotension

Beta blockers can cause significant blood pressure reductions, leading to symptoms like dizziness, fainting, or falls, especially in patients who are volume-depleted or on multiple antihypertensive agents.

3. Fatigue and Reduced Exercise Tolerance

Patients often report fatigue and decreased ability to engage in physical activity, which can impact quality of life and adherence to therapy.

4. Respiratory Issues

Non-selective beta blockers may exacerbate respiratory conditions such as asthma or chronic obstructive pulmonary disease (COPD) by blocking beta-2 receptors in the lungs, leading to bronchoconstriction.

Strategies and Solutions

1. Dose Adjustment and Monitoring

Start with low doses and titrate gradually while monitoring heart rate and blood pressure. Regular follow-up allows early detection of adverse effects and dose adjustments.

2. Patient Education

Educate patients about potential side effects, warning signs, and the importance of adherence. Encourage reporting of symptoms such as dizziness, fatigue, or breathing difficulties.

3. Selecting the Appropriate Beta Blocker

Choose cardioselective beta blockers (e.g., atenolol, metoprolol) for patients with respiratory issues to minimize bronchoconstriction. Consider patient comorbidities when selecting the agent.

4. Managing Comorbid Conditions

Coordinate care with other healthcare providers to optimize management of comorbidities, such as adjusting antihypertensive therapy or treating respiratory conditions to reduce the risk of adverse effects.
